**Vendor note: Inkmill markdown pipeline**

Rendering for Parchway docs is outsourced to Inkmill under an annual contract, renewing each March. They handle sanitization and PDF export; we own the upload queue. SLA: 4-hour response on rendering failures. Escalate only after two failed retries. Their support desk is reachable at the address below.

billing contact of hahaf-baguf = zorael.tammir.jorius@sivrelhq.internal

Handover on the Marrowset session-token refresh bug: tokens issued near the hourly rotation window sometimes fail to refresh, logging users out of the Ledgerline console. A patch is staged behind the rotation-grace flag and needs soak time before the next release. Keep the flag off in production until QA confirms no duplicate-session regressions. Test results, flag state history, and the rollout plan are tracked on the internal page below.

dashboard of tahag-bajef = https://confluence.zemvarlabs.internal/projects/pages/projects/f53ad3f4

Test plan for PruneBot, our stale-branch cleanup bot. We'll seed the Wrenfield test org with branches aged 10, 30, and 90 days, then verify the bot warns at 30 and deletes at 90, skipping anything with an open merge request. Dry-run mode gets tested first. Running the suite against the sandbox API requires the service account's token, included below.

portal login ticket: eyJhbGciOiJIUzI1NiIsInR5cCI6IkpXVCJ9.eyJzdWIiOiIMjvRAf3PEFIn0.nuv9gjixLtnr

Ticket #9107 – Pricing experiment DB drops

Farepoint experiment service losing connections every ~20 min since this morning. Variant assignment still works; price writes are failing, so some users see stale fares. Not customer-critical yet but getting noisy. Restarting the pod helps for a while. Suspect pool exhaustion from the new cohort query. Check active sessions before escalating. Use the connection string below to inspect the pricing tables.

replica DSN, kajep-yahag: mssql://praok_svc:iF@db-8d68.plorvaio.local:5432/eliion